终极指南:让老旧Mac焕发新生的OpenCore实战手册
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
OpenCore Legacy Patcher(OCLP)是一款革命性的开源工具,专门为被苹果官方放弃支持的Intel架构Mac设备提供现代化的macOS系统兼容性解决方案。无论你使用的是2008年的iMac还是2012年的MacBook Pro,这个工具都能帮助你的设备运行最新的macOS版本,有效延长设备使用寿命。本指南将带你深入了解如何利用这个强大工具,让你的老款Mac设备重获新生。
为什么你的老款Mac需要OpenCore Legacy Patcher?
苹果公司通常会为设备提供5-7年的系统更新支持,这意味着许多功能完好的设备被过早"淘汰"。OpenCore Legacy Patcher通过精密的引导加载程序配置和系统级补丁技术,完美解决了这个痛点。
核心优势对比表:
| 特性 | 官方支持 | OCLP解决方案 |
|---|---|---|
| 系统版本支持 | 有限年份 | 几乎所有现代版本 |
| 硬件驱动兼容 | 仅限原厂 | 扩展第三方驱动支持 |
| 系统安全更新 | 受限于硬件 | 持续获得安全补丁 |
准备工作:搭建完美升级环境
系统要求检查清单
在进行升级前,请确保满足以下条件:
- 至少8GB可用存储空间
- 稳定的网络连接
- 当前系统为macOS 10.13或更高版本
- 备份所有重要数据
获取OpenCore Legacy Patcher
git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her cd OpenCore-Legacy-Patcher实战步骤:从零开始完成系统升级
第一步:启动主程序界面
OpenCore Legacy Patcher主菜单 - 提供四大核心功能模块的直观入口
主界面设计简洁明了,四个主要功能按钮对应完整升级流程:
- 构建安装OpenCore- 创建定制化的引导环境
- 根补丁应用- 安装硬件驱动和系统兼容性补丁
- 创建安装器- 制作macOS安装U盘或磁盘
- 技术支持- 获取帮助文档和资源
第二步:构建OpenCore配置
这是整个过程中最关键的一步。OCLP会自动检测你的硬件配置,并生成完全适配的引导文件。
构建过程关键点:
- 自动识别CPU型号和架构
- 检测显卡类型并配置相应驱动
- 优化内存和电源管理设置
OpenCore配置构建完成 - 显示构建日志和安装选项
第三步:应用系统补丁
系统安装完成后,需要应用特定的硬件补丁来确保所有功能正常工作。
根补丁管理菜单 - 支持图形加速、音频驱动等关键补丁
补丁类型详解:
| 补丁类别 | 解决的主要问题 | 适用硬件 |
|---|---|---|
| 图形加速补丁 | 显卡驱动兼容性 | AMD/NVIDIA/Intel各代显卡 |
| 音频驱动补丁 | 声卡功能恢复 | 各型号内置声卡 |
| 网络适配补丁 | 无线和有线连接 | 旧款网卡芯片 |
| 电源管理补丁 | 电池和性能优化 | 所有移动设备 |
第四步:安全配置优化
系统完整性保护(SIP)的正确配置是确保补丁正常工作的关键。
系统安全配置界面 - 提供细粒度的权限控制选项
推荐的SIP配置参数:
# 平衡安全性与兼容性的配置 csr-active-config: 0x67F # 各权限位含义 - 0x001: 允许任务控制 - 0x002: 允许内核调试 - 0x010: 允许未经签名的kext加载 - 0x020: 允许任意kext加载 - 0x040: 禁用库验证 - 0x080: 允许未经授权的root操作常见问题与解决方案
问题一:引导失败
症状:开机后无法进入系统,停留在黑屏或错误界面
解决方案:
- 重新运行OCLP构建流程
- 检查EFI分区是否正确安装
- 验证硬件配置是否支持目标系统
问题二:图形显示异常
症状:屏幕闪烁、分辨率错误、颜色异常
解决方案:
- 重新应用图形加速补丁
- 检查显卡驱动是否正确加载
- 调整显示参数配置
问题三:网络连接问题
症状:无法连接WiFi或有线网络
解决方案:
- 应用网络适配补丁
- 检查网络驱动状态
- 更新无线网卡固件
性能优化技巧
内存管理优化
针对不同内存配置的优化建议:
| 内存大小 | 推荐配置 | 预期效果 |
|---|---|---|
| 4GB及以下 | 启用内存压缩 | 提升多任务处理能力 |
| 8GB | 优化虚拟内存设置 | 平衡性能与稳定性 |
| 16GB及以上 | 最大化性能模式 | 充分发挥硬件潜力 |
电池续航优化
对于笔记本电脑用户,电池管理至关重要:
- 使用CPUFriend优化电源管理
- 调整屏幕亮度策略
- 优化后台进程管理
风险控制与备份策略
风险评估框架
在进行升级前,请评估你的设备风险等级:
低风险设备:官方支持边缘型号,硬件与支持设备相似度高中风险设备:需要较多补丁支持,可能存在稳定性问题
高风险设备:硬件差异较大,建议谨慎操作
完整的备份方案
- Time Machine全盘备份- 确保数据安全
- EFI分区备份- 保留原始引导配置
- 系统快照创建- 便于快速恢复
成功案例分享
案例一:2012年MacBook Pro升级macOS Sequoia
设备配置:
- Intel Core i7处理器
- 8GB内存
- NVIDIA GeForce GT 650M显卡
升级结果:
- 成功运行最新macOS系统
- 所有硬件功能正常工作
- 性能表现稳定流畅
案例二:2008年iMac焕发新生
技术挑战:
- Intel Core 2 Duo处理器性能限制
- NVIDIA GeForce 8800 GS显卡驱动
- 旧款接口兼容性问题
解决方案效果:
- 系统响应速度明显提升
- 支持现代应用程序运行
- 获得最新安全更新保护
维护与更新指南
定期维护检查清单
- 检查系统更新状态
- 验证补丁兼容性
- 备份重要数据
- 更新OCLP到最新版本
版本更新流程
OCLP提供智能更新检测机制:
- 自动检查新版本
- 下载增量更新包
- 验证文件完整性
- 应用更新内容
总结与展望
OpenCore Legacy Patcher为老款Mac设备提供了持续的技术支持,通过精密的系统级补丁和引导配置优化,有效延长了设备的使用寿命。无论你是想要体验最新macOS功能的普通用户,还是希望为老旧设备提供技术支持的技术爱好者,这个工具都能为你提供完美的解决方案。
通过本指南的详细步骤和实用技巧,你将能够:
- 安全地为老款Mac升级系统
- 解决各种硬件兼容性问题
- 优化设备性能和用户体验
- 延长设备使用寿命3-5年
记住,技术发展的目标是让更多人受益。OpenCore Legacy Patcher正是这样一个工具,它让原本被"淘汰"的设备重获新生,为环保和资源节约做出贡献。
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考